Why House Building Companies Prioritize Cost‑Efficiency Without Sacrificing Quality
Builders face a tightrope: margins shrink while client expectations swell. Cost‑efficiency matters because it frees resources for higher‑grade materials, tighter tolerances, and more thorough inspections. At the same time, cutting corners on quality invites rework, warranty claims, and reputational damage—costs that far exceed any upfront savings.
- Financial health: Streamlined spending protects cash flow, allowing firms to invest in skilled tradespeople and advanced equipment.
- Client trust: Homeowners notice the difference when finishes sit flush, doors swing smoothly, and energy bills stay low. Those details, rooted in quality, turn first‑time buyers into repeat customers.
- Regulatory pressure: Many jurisdictions now require energy‑performance certifications; meeting them efficiently often means using better‑engineered components, which paradoxically lowers long‑term operating costs.
In practice, seasoned contractors treat cost‑efficiency and quality as partners, not rivals. They ask, “How can we achieve the same—or better—outcome with fewer resources?” The answer begins with the building blocks of modern construction: prefabrication.
Step 1 – Adopt Prefabricated Modules to Slash Labor Hours and Material Waste
Prefabricated, or “prefab,” modules are built in a controlled factory setting before being shipped to the site for assembly. This shift changes the labor equation dramatically. On‑site crews spend minutes—rather than days—installing walls, floor panels, or even complete bathroom pods.
Why it works:
- Reduced labor hours: Repetitive tasks become assembly‑line operations, letting workers focus on precision rather than fatigue‑induced errors.
- Minimized waste: Factories cut material offcuts with computer‑guided saws, achieving nesting efficiencies that are impossible on a chaotic job‑site.
- Weather independence: Production continues regardless of rain or temperature, so schedules stay on track and costs don’t balloon from delays.
Real‑world snapshot: A mid‑size home builder in the Pacific Northwest reported a 30 % drop in on‑site labor time after switching to factory‑built wall panels. The same project saw a 12 % reduction in material waste, translating into lower disposal fees and a tighter carbon footprint.
Getting started:
- Identify repeatable components (e.g., exterior wall sections, roof trusses).
- Partner with a local prefab shop that can customize dimensions while maintaining tight tolerances.
- Map out delivery logistics early to avoid last‑minute site congestion.
By integrating prefabricated modules, firms lay a foundation—both literal and strategic—that supports the next steps in a cost‑efficient, quality‑first construction journey.
Step 2 – Harness Digital Design Tools for Precise Planning and Fewer Change Orders
When a design lives in a 3‑D model instead of a stack of paper sheets, every dimension, material count, and connection point can be verified before the first hammer swing. Practitioners report that clash‑detection software catches on‑site conflicts — like a duct that would intersect a structural beam — hours before they become costly re‑work. For example, a builder in Texas used a cloud‑based BIM (Building Information Modeling) platform to run a “what‑if” analysis on a floor‑plan tweak; the simulation revealed that the new kitchen island would push the electrical conduit into a load‑bearing wall. By redesigning the island in the model, the team avoided a change order that would have added $7,500 in labor and material fees.
Beyond error‑proofing, digital tools feed straight into scheduling and budgeting apps, letting owners see real‑time cost impacts of design decisions. The result is a tighter link between what the market expects and what the construction crew actually delivers, slashing the number of late‑stage modifications that typically erode profit margins.
To get started, consider these three low‑friction steps:
- Choose a BIM platform that integrates with your estimating software – most vendors offer a free trial, so you can evaluate ease of use before committing.
- Create a “design freeze” checkpoint after the schematic phase; any subsequent changes must pass through a cost‑impact review in the model.
- Train field supervisors on the mobile viewer so they can flag discrepancies on site without waiting for a desk‑bound engineer.
By embedding precise digital planning early, you build a buffer that protects both schedule and quality, laying the groundwork for the next efficiency lever.
Step 3 – Standardize Supply‑Chain Partnerships for Bulk Pricing and Reliable Delivery
Even the most sophisticated design can stall if the right parts don’t arrive when needed. Builders who lock in a handful of vetted vendors—rather than juggling dozens of ad‑hoc suppliers—gain two distinct advantages: predictable pricing and synchronized logistics. In practice, a developer in Florida consolidated his exterior‑cladding purchases with a single mill, negotiating a volume discount that shaved 8 % off the unit cost. Because the mill also handled freight planning, delivery windows aligned with the prefab wall installation schedule discussed earlier, eliminating the dreaded “waiting for windows” bottleneck that often triggers cost overruns.
Standardization also pays dividends when a company expands into new developments across a region. With a core supplier list, the procurement team can replicate successful contracts in each market, leveraging the same bulk‑order leverage without renegotiating from scratch. This replicability reduces the administrative overhead of tendering processes and ensures that quality standards remain consistent from one subdivision to the next.
Here’s a quick roadmap to tighten your supply chain:
- Identify high‑volume items (e.g., drywall panels, insulation batts, pre‑finished cabinetry) that appear on most projects.
- Score potential partners on price, lead‑time reliability, and quality certifications—a simple spreadsheet can surface the true cost of “cheapest” versus “most dependable.”
- Negotiate framework agreements that lock in unit rates for a 12‑ to 24‑month horizon, with clauses for penalty‑free adjustments if delivery windows shift.
- Implement a shared inventory dashboard so the on‑site crew, the prefab shop, and the supplier can see real‑time stock levels and adjust orders proactively.
When supply‑chain relationships become a strategic asset rather than a transactional afterthought, the whole construction workflow smooths out, allowing the cost‑efficiency gains from prefabrication and digital design to shine through without interruption.
